## Runbook: Hermetic Build Migration (Ridgeline)

New folks: we're moving the Ridgeline build off the old shell-script pipeline onto the Cobblework hermetic build system. All dependencies are now pinned in the lockfile — no network fetches during builds, ever. If a target fails with a sandbox violation, it almost certainly reads from an unpinned path; fix the dependency declaration rather than loosening the sandbox. Outputs from Cobblework must be signed before the release bucket accepts them. The current release signing key is:

rollout seal: bky6_osViJn

Handover: Dedupe service (Quellbird) is stable but watch the merge-window lag metric. Last night it spiked after the Tallowfield cluster failover; self-recovered in 20 min. If duplicates leak into PagePulse, restart the coalescer pod first, don't touch the hash store. Suppression rules were updated Tuesday — review before editing. Escalate to Mireille only if leak persists past an hour. Full triage steps are on the internal page here.

operations page: https://jenkins.zemvarcloud.local/job/merge_requests/repo/build/73930b4b30f0a8ed

Subject: Who owns rate limiting now

Hi all, welcome aboard! Small but important update: ownership of the rate limiting layer in our internal API gateway, Gatewren, has changed hands. That covers per-team quotas, burst allowances, and the dreaded 429 tuning. If a service suddenly starts getting throttled, don't guess — file a ticket and tag the owner directly. They also review all quota-increase requests, so loop them in early rather than after launch. Going forward, the person responsible for all of this is:

signatory, kafop-bahaf: Lamion Queniel Jorir Olidor

// Scrollcase audit-log viewer: pagination and retention knobs.
// On-call: if queries time out, lower the page size before touching
// the scan window — widening the window is what usually causes
// incidents. Retention pruning runs hourly and is safe to pause.
// Defaults below were set after the March load test:

tuning constants:
RATE_LIMITS = {
    "goriel": 284,
    "brieth": 236,
    "lamvan": 916,
    "druok": 255,
    "wenion": 979,
    "istmir": 343,
    "queniel": 302,
}